Book excerpt: Written by a speech and language therapist and a secondary teacher working in mainstream schools, this highly illustrated pocketbook begins by defining SLCN and placing it against a backdrop of normal language development. The authors identify who has SLCN and explain how weak communication skills lead to academic, social, emotional and behavioural problems.
